brourke228 wrote:Currently we have Confidential Mission and Sonic Adventure 2 backed up. In addition, we have set up a web portal to access these websites on DC. Having a single site which links to all the rest makes it easier for redirecting the games. Because after they are redirected via DNS they will be trying to access the server by ip address and if there are multiple websites with same file name for the html file at the top of the website's structure they will be accessing the same file. Like sonic adventure and confidential mission could both have an index.html at the top of their website and this would cause problems when hosting them both on a single server.
Anyway having a web portal to direct to the other game websites gives us the opportunity to do some other things. The plan is to direct all the games' website buttons to that web portal where you can then click the game sites button to select which site you'd like to view. It's a couple extra links to go through but this makes it easier for us.
The only way we can have every game go directly to the game website right now is through modifying the disc with hex edit.
